Understanding the Role of a Wind Engineer

A Wind Engineer plays a critical role in evaluating wind resources and optimizing wind energy projects. This position is key to harnessing renewable energy while ensuring that projects meet technical and environmental standards. Wind Engineers work closely with interdisciplinary teams to analyze wind data, model wind flow, and contribute to innovative energy solutions.

What Does a Wind Engineer Do?

Wind Engineers are responsible for:

  • Analyzing wind data from various sources, including meteorological towers and remote sensing devices.
  • Conducting comprehensive wind resource assessments to determine optimal sites for energy projects.
  • Developing technical models using industry-standard software (e.g., WAsP, CFD) to simulate wind conditions and predict performance.
  • Collaborating with project stakeholders and engineers to design and optimize turbine layouts and energy yield.

By leveraging strong analytical skills and technical expertise, Wind Engineers ensure that their organizations remain at the forefront of sustainable energy technology.

Key Responsibilities for a Wind Engineer

  • Data Analysis: Analyze wind data from diverse sources.
  • Resource Assessments: Evaluate site suitability for wind energy projects.
  • Modeling: Develop and use wind flow models to predict wind behavior.
  • Optimization: Perform energy yield assessments and optimize turbine layouts.
  • Reporting: Prepare technical reports and presentations.
  • Collaboration: Work effectively with cross-disciplinary project teams.
  • Continuous Learning: Stay updated on wind energy technology and best practices.

What We’re Looking For 🔍

  • Educational Background: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Aerospace, Civil, Environmental, or related fields). A Master’s degree is a plus.
  • Technical Expertise: Strong understanding of fluid mechanics, aerodynamics, and meteorology.
  • Experience: Proven background in wind resource assessments and proficiency with industry-standard software.
  • Analytical Skills: Ability to accurately analyze data and create statistical models.
  • Team Player: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to work both independently and collaboratively.
  • Preferred Qualifications: Experience with CFD modeling, wind turbine design, and familiarity with industry standards and regulations.
